> Commit ae24345da54e ("bpf: Implement an interface to register
> bpf_iter targets") and its subsequent commits in the same patch set
> introduced bpf iterator, a way to run bpf program when iterating
> kernel data structures.
>
> This patch set addressed some followup issues. One big change
> is to allow target to pass ctx arg register types to verifier
> for verification purpose. Please see individual patch for details.
